Runes have long been used as tools of divination and magic by various ancient cultures, particularly Norse and Germanic tribes. These symbols hold significant power and are believed to possess specific attributes and energies that can be harnessed for various purposes, including health and protection. When it comes to health, certain runes are associated with healing and overall well-being. Algiz, for example, is a rune that represents protection and divine guidance. It can be used to invoke these qualities and provide a shield of protection against negative energies or ailments that may harm one's health. Similarly, Ehwaz, which symbolizes trust and connection, can aid in improving overall physical and mental well-being, promoting balance and harmony within oneself.

Rune of Protection Prayers

Runes of Protection Prayers are runes that provide an attribute bonus to Protection Prayers. These runes are only usable by primary monks.

  • A Monk Rune of Minor Protection Prayers provides a bonus of +1 Protection Prayers.
  • A Monk Rune of Major Protection Prayers provides a bonus of +2 Protection Prayers and a penalty of -35 health.
  • A Monk Rune of Superior Protection Prayers provides a bonus of +3 Protection Prayers and a penalty of -75 health.

The Protection Prayers bonus is non-stacking, but the health penalty stacks.

Sowulo can be used to tap into the regenerative power of the sun, bring vitality, and enhance the body's natural healing abilities. It is also believed to cleanse and strengthen the aura, promoting overall health and vitality. When it comes to protection, ancient cultures often used runes to ward off evil and negative energies. The rune Thurisaz, for example, represents the thorn or a protective barrier. It can be used to create a shield against harmful influences, preventing physical or emotional harm. Likewise, Inguz, which symbolizes fertility and new beginnings, can be invoked to create a protective barrier and ward off any negative energies or situations. Another rune associated with protection is Othala, which represents ancestral heritage and spiritual protection. It can be used to connect with one's ancestors for guidance and protection, creating a sense of rootedness and stability. Othala is believed to form a strong protective shield around an individual, safeguarding them from any harm or adversity. It is important to note that while runes can be powerful tools, their usage should be approached with respect and knowledge. It is advisable to consult a knowledgeable practitioner or do thorough research before using runes for health and protection. Additionally, runes should not be considered a substitute for professional medical advice or treatment.
